Output 08a0468fa12822e22e698e546cfe520dc59f127c0f3dc752728bb8ebca3a39a2:2

value
26730960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a129d175f20d77a302d47750aa94ff2b7810d85 OP_EQUAL
address
3HCH6TEg8iHcGUu8LoYLJaAL3fFV1GkCb7
transaction
08a0468fa12822e22e698e546cfe520dc59f127c0f3dc752728bb8ebca3a39a2
spent
true